All of lore.kernel.org
 help / color / mirror / Atom feed
* [Bug 13520] New: WARNING: at lib/dma-debug.c:576 check_for_illegal_area+0xd3/0xfd()
@ 2009-06-12 13:43 bugzilla-daemon
  2009-06-15  8:41 ` [Bug 13520] " bugzilla-daemon
                   ` (3 more replies)
  0 siblings, 4 replies; 6+ messages in thread
From: bugzilla-daemon @ 2009-06-12 13:43 UTC (permalink / raw)
  To: linux-ide

http://bugzilla.kernel.org/show_bug.cgi?id=13520

           Summary: WARNING: at lib/dma-debug.c:576
                    check_for_illegal_area+0xd3/0xfd()
           Product: IO/Storage
           Version: 2.5
    Kernel Version: 2.6.30
          Platform: All
        OS/Version: Linux
              Tree: Mainline
            Status: NEW
          Severity: normal
          Priority: P1
         Component: IDE
        AssignedTo: io_ide@kernel-bugs.osdl.org
        ReportedBy: randrik@mail.ru
        Regression: No


Created an attachment (id=21877)
 --> (http://bugzilla.kernel.org/attachment.cgi?id=21877)
My .config

Nothing dangerous, I hope, but i saw this warning twice.



Adding 399992k swap on /swap.file.  Priority:-1 extents:728 across:2152036k
------------[ cut here ]------------
WARNING: at lib/dma-debug.c:576 check_for_illegal_area+0xd3/0xfd()
Hardware name: MS-6380E
VIA_IDE 0000:00:11.1: DMA-API: device driver maps memory from kernel text or
rodata [addr=c0ffc000] [size=16384]
Modules linked in: snd_seq_dummy snd_seq_oss snd_seq_midi_event snd_seq
snd_pcm_oss snd_mixer_oss sg sd_mod ipv6 nfsd lockd nfs_acl auth_rpcgss sunrpc
usb_storage scsi_mod usb_libusual tuner_simple tuner_types tda9887 tda8290
nouveau ppdev snd_cs4236 snd_mpu401 ttm snd_wavefront uhci_hcd fb saa7134
snd_emu10k1 snd_via82xx snd_ac97_codec snd_wss_lib ac97_bus ehci_hcd ir_common
snd_opl3_lib snd_mpu401_uart snd_pcm videobuf_dma_sg snd_timer snd_page_alloc
snd_rawmidi videobuf_core tveeprom snd_util_mem snd_seq_device snd_hwdep
rtc_cmos drm usbcore i2c_algo_bit cfbcopyarea emu10k1_gp cfbimgblt cfbfillrect
rtc_core parport_pc rtc_lib ns558 snd 8139too floppy parport soundcore gameport
shpchp via_agp pci_hotplug xfs exportfs ufs agpgart tuner v4l2_common videodev
v4l1_compat w83627hf hwmon_vid hwmon i2c_viapro i2c_dev
Pid: 87, comm: kblockd/0 Not tainted 2.6.30-i486 #4
Call Trace:
 [<c1031c86>] warn_slowpath_common+0x65/0x95
 [<c1031cf4>] warn_slowpath_fmt+0x29/0x2c
 [<c11611df>] check_for_illegal_area+0xd3/0xfd
 [<c11622a4>] debug_dma_map_sg+0x13b/0x147
 [<c11cfae1>] ide_dma_prepare+0xc2/0x10b
 [<c11cbaba>] do_rw_taskfile+0x221/0x261
 [<c11d9990>] ide_do_rw_disk+0x23d/0x2b4
 [<c114ee9b>] ? delay_tsc+0x47/0x6c
 [<c11d9077>] ide_gd_do_request+0xf/0x12
 [<c11c8cc8>] do_ide_request+0x345/0x4a1
 [<c105374a>] ? trace_hardirqs_off_caller+0x18/0xa3
 [<c10537e0>] ? trace_hardirqs_off+0xb/0xd
 [<c128f8e1>] ? _spin_unlock_irqrestore+0x34/0x41
 [<c103ae8f>] ? del_timer+0x4a/0x52
 [<c113d670>] ? blk_remove_plug+0x109/0x114
 [<c113d736>] __generic_unplug_device+0x46/0x4a
 [<c113d77b>] blk_start_queueing+0x41/0x45
 [<c1146460>] cfq_kick_queue+0x21/0x2f
 [<c10412b2>] worker_thread+0x1d4/0x2ce
 [<c1041265>] ? worker_thread+0x187/0x2ce
 [<c114643f>] ? cfq_kick_queue+0x0/0x2f
 [<c1044d0c>] ? autoremove_wake_function+0x0/0x38
 [<c10410de>] ? worker_thread+0x0/0x2ce
 [<c1044a09>] kthread+0x4a/0x70
 [<c10449bf>] ? kthread+0x0/0x70
 [<c1003a87>] kernel_thread_helper+0x7/0x10
---[ end trace fa41507272d4fe04 ]---

and second time today

reconnect_path: npd != pd
mtrr: no MTRR for c0000000,10000000 found
------------[ cut here ]------------
WARNING: at lib/dma-debug.c:576 check_for_illegal_area+0xd3/0xfd()
Hardware name: MS-6380E
VIA_IDE 0000:00:11.1: DMA-API: device driver maps memory from kernel text or
rodata [addr=c0fff000] [size=4096]
Modules linked in: sg sd_mod snd_seq_dummy snd_seq_oss snd_seq_midi_event
snd_seq snd_pcm_oss snd_mixer_oss ipv6 nfsd lockd nfs_acl auth_rpcgss sunrpc
usb_storage scsi_mod usb_libusual tuner_simple tuner_types tda9887 snd_cs4236
tda8290 snd_mpu401 ppdev snd_via82xx snd_emu10k1 snd_wavefront snd_wss_lib
snd_ac97_codec ac97_bus saa7134 uhci_hcd snd_pcm ehci_hcd ir_common
snd_opl3_lib videobuf_dma_sg snd_mpu401_uart snd_timer snd_page_alloc
videobuf_core snd_rawmidi snd_util_mem tveeprom snd_seq_device usbcore shpchp
snd_hwdep 8139too emu10k1_gp rtc_cmos pci_hotplug via_agp parport_pc rtc_core
ns558 rtc_lib snd parport floppy gameport soundcore xfs exportfs ufs agpgart
tuner v4l2_common videodev v4l1_compat w83627hf hwmon_vid hwmon i2c_viapro
i2c_dev [last unloaded: cfbfillrect]
Pid: 1542, comm: kjournald Not tainted 2.6.30-i486 #4
Call Trace:
 [<c1031c86>] warn_slowpath_common+0x65/0x95
 [<c1031cf4>] warn_slowpath_fmt+0x29/0x2c
 [<c11611df>] check_for_illegal_area+0xd3/0xfd
 [<c11622a4>] debug_dma_map_sg+0x13b/0x147
 [<c11cfae1>] ide_dma_prepare+0xc2/0x10b
 [<c11cbaba>] do_rw_taskfile+0x221/0x261
 [<c11d9990>] ide_do_rw_disk+0x23d/0x2b4
 [<c114ee9b>] ? delay_tsc+0x47/0x6c
 [<c11d9077>] ide_gd_do_request+0xf/0x12
 [<c11c8cc8>] do_ide_request+0x345/0x4a1
 [<c105374a>] ? trace_hardirqs_off_caller+0x18/0xa3
 [<c10537e0>] ? trace_hardirqs_off+0xb/0xd
 [<c128f8e1>] ? _spin_unlock_irqrestore+0x34/0x41
 [<c103ae8f>] ? del_timer+0x4a/0x52
 [<c113d670>] ? blk_remove_plug+0x109/0x114
 [<c113d736>] __generic_unplug_device+0x46/0x4a
 [<c113de7c>] __make_request+0x3d5/0x3ea
 [<c113ba4d>] ? trace_block_remap+0x2f/0x5f
 [<c113c5ab>] generic_make_request+0x262/0x2a5
 [<c1093ac0>] ? mempool_alloc+0x5f/0x111
 [<c113c6b7>] submit_bio+0xc9/0xd1
 [<c10df797>] ? bio_alloc_bioset+0x8d/0x10e
 [<c10dafcc>] submit_bh+0x10d/0x12b
 [<c10dc87d>] sync_dirty_buffer+0x72/0xaf
 [<c11195bc>] journal_commit_transaction+0xb0b/0xf4f
 [<c10537e0>] ? trace_hardirqs_off+0xb/0xd
 [<c103ae3d>] ? try_to_del_timer_sync+0x44/0x4c
 [<c111c806>] kjournald+0xcc/0x1ed
 [<c1044d0c>] ? autoremove_wake_function+0x0/0x38
 [<c111c73a>] ? kjournald+0x0/0x1ed
 [<c1044a09>] kthread+0x4a/0x70
 [<c10449bf>] ? kthread+0x0/0x70
 [<c1003a87>] kernel_thread_helper+0x7/0x10
---[ end trace a9c5ff347ea44ae3 ]---

-- 
Configure bugmail: http://bugzilla.kernel.org/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are watching the assignee of the bug.

^ permalink raw reply	[flat|nested] 6+ messages in thread

* [Bug 13520] WARNING: at lib/dma-debug.c:576 check_for_illegal_area+0xd3/0xfd()
  2009-06-12 13:43 [Bug 13520] New: WARNING: at lib/dma-debug.c:576 check_for_illegal_area+0xd3/0xfd() bugzilla-daemon
@ 2009-06-15  8:41 ` bugzilla-daemon
  2009-06-15 17:39 ` bugzilla-daemon
                   ` (2 subsequent siblings)
  3 siblings, 0 replies; 6+ messages in thread
From: bugzilla-daemon @ 2009-06-15  8:41 UTC (permalink / raw)
  To: linux-ide

http://bugzilla.kernel.org/show_bug.cgi?id=13520


Joerg Roedel <joro@8bytes.org> chang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
                 CC|                            |joro@8bytes.org




--- Comment #1 from Joerg Roedel <joro@8bytes.org>  2009-06-15 08:41:24 ---
I currently think this is a driver bug. But to be sure can you please upload
the vmlinux file of the failing kernel somewhere so I can have a look at the
addresses of the segment boundary symbols?

-- 
Configure bugmail: http://bugzilla.kernel.org/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are watching the assignee of the bug.

^ permalink raw reply	[flat|nested] 6+ messages in thread

* [Bug 13520] WARNING: at lib/dma-debug.c:576 check_for_illegal_area+0xd3/0xfd()
  2009-06-12 13:43 [Bug 13520] New: WARNING: at lib/dma-debug.c:576 check_for_illegal_area+0xd3/0xfd() bugzilla-daemon
  2009-06-15  8:41 ` [Bug 13520] " bugzilla-daemon
@ 2009-06-15 17:39 ` bugzilla-daemon
  2009-06-16 10:28 ` bugzilla-daemon
  2009-06-17 13:46 ` bugzilla-daemon
  3 siblings, 0 replies; 6+ messages in thread
From: bugzilla-daemon @ 2009-06-15 17:39 UTC (permalink / raw)
  To: linux-ide

http://bugzilla.kernel.org/show_bug.cgi?id=13520





--- Comment #2 from Andrew Randrianasulu <randrik@mail.ru>  2009-06-15 17:39:34 ---
http://url.file.am/?DJvfr 


md5sum: dc6da35c982542b8c083edae790ceb8c  kernel-2.6.30.bz2

-- 
Configure bugmail: http://bugzilla.kernel.org/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are watching the assignee of the bug.

^ permalink raw reply	[flat|nested] 6+ messages in thread

* [Bug 13520] WARNING: at lib/dma-debug.c:576 check_for_illegal_area+0xd3/0xfd()
  2009-06-12 13:43 [Bug 13520] New: WARNING: at lib/dma-debug.c:576 check_for_illegal_area+0xd3/0xfd() bugzilla-daemon
  2009-06-15  8:41 ` [Bug 13520] " bugzilla-daemon
  2009-06-15 17:39 ` bugzilla-daemon
@ 2009-06-16 10:28 ` bugzilla-daemon
  2009-06-17 13:51   ` Bartlomiej Zolnierkiewicz
  2009-06-17 13:46 ` bugzilla-daemon
  3 siblings, 1 reply; 6+ messages in thread
From: bugzilla-daemon @ 2009-06-16 10:28 UTC (permalink / raw)
  To: linux-ide

http://bugzilla.kernel.org/show_bug.cgi?id=13520





--- Comment #3 from Joerg Roedel <joro@8bytes.org>  2009-06-16 10:27:59 ---
Ok, this was a dma-debug bug. The two warnings above are for memory areas which
exactly ends at the beginning of the kernel text segment. I queued a fix in my
tree and send it out when -rc1 is released. I also marked the patch for stable
backporting.

-- 
Configure bugmail: http://bugzilla.kernel.org/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are watching the assignee of the bug.

^ permalink raw reply	[flat|nested] 6+ messages in thread

* [Bug 13520] WARNING: at lib/dma-debug.c:576 check_for_illegal_area+0xd3/0xfd()
  2009-06-12 13:43 [Bug 13520] New: WARNING: at lib/dma-debug.c:576 check_for_illegal_area+0xd3/0xfd() bugzilla-daemon
                   ` (2 preceding siblings ...)
  2009-06-16 10:28 ` bugzilla-daemon
@ 2009-06-17 13:46 ` bugzilla-daemon
  3 siblings, 0 replies; 6+ messages in thread
From: bugzilla-daemon @ 2009-06-17 13:46 UTC (permalink / raw)
  To: linux-ide

http://bugzilla.kernel.org/show_bug.cgi?id=13520





--- Comment #4 from Bartlomiej Zolnierkiewicz <bzolnier@gmail.com>  2009-06-17 13:46:14 ---
On Tuesday 16 June 2009 12:28:01 bugzilla-daemon@bugzilla.kernel.org wrote:
> http://bugzilla.kernel.org/show_bug.cgi?id=13520
> 
> 
> 
> 
> 
> --- Comment #3 from Joerg Roedel <joro@8bytes.org>  2009-06-16 10:27:59 ---
> Ok, this was a dma-debug bug. The two warnings above are for memory areas which
> exactly ends at the beginning of the kernel text segment. I queued a fix in my
> tree and send it out when -rc1 is released. I also marked the patch for stable
> backporting.

Could you please post a link to the fix and then close the bug?  Thanks.

-- 
Configure bugmail: http://bugzilla.kernel.org/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are watching the assignee of the bug.

^ permalink raw reply	[flat|nested] 6+ messages in thread

* Re: [Bug 13520] WARNING: at lib/dma-debug.c:576 check_for_illegal_area+0xd3/0xfd()
  2009-06-16 10:28 ` bugzilla-daemon
@ 2009-06-17 13:51   ` Bartlomiej Zolnierkiewicz
  0 siblings, 0 replies; 6+ messages in thread
From: Bartlomiej Zolnierkiewicz @ 2009-06-17 13:51 UTC (permalink / raw)
  To: bugzilla-daemon; +Cc: linux-ide

On Tuesday 16 June 2009 12:28:01 bugzilla-daemon@bugzilla.kernel.org wrote:
> http://bugzilla.kernel.org/show_bug.cgi?id=13520
> 
> 
> 
> 
> 
> --- Comment #3 from Joerg Roedel <joro@8bytes.org>  2009-06-16 10:27:59 ---
> Ok, this was a dma-debug bug. The two warnings above are for memory areas which
> exactly ends at the beginning of the kernel text segment. I queued a fix in my
> tree and send it out when -rc1 is released. I also marked the patch for stable
> backporting.

Could you please post a link to the fix and then close the bug?  Thanks.

^ permalink raw reply	[flat|nested] 6+ messages in thread

end of thread, other threads:[~2009-06-17 13:46 UTC | newest]

Thread overview: 6+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2009-06-12 13:43 [Bug 13520] New: WARNING: at lib/dma-debug.c:576 check_for_illegal_area+0xd3/0xfd() bugzilla-daemon
2009-06-15  8:41 ` [Bug 13520] " bugzilla-daemon
2009-06-15 17:39 ` bugzilla-daemon
2009-06-16 10:28 ` bugzilla-daemon
2009-06-17 13:51   ` Bartlomiej Zolnierkiewicz
2009-06-17 13:46 ` bugzilla-daemon

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.